We were excited to finally get a gf donut! We drove 30 minutes out of our way to get there and were very displeased to be told by the person behind the counter that they aren’t gluten free. She referred to their donuts as “gluten friendly” which is normally the “we can’t guarantee their won’t be any cross contamination” answer you get everywhere, but went on to explain that while their donuts are made using gluten free flour they dust the finished products with flour so they don’t stick to the racks they store them on. She then seemed surprised that we were not going to get any. That was possibly the most frustrating part because she didn’t seem to understand that we don’t eat gluten because it would make us ill, and that it isn’t just a fad. Donuts are cut on the same dough table as regular donuts (meaning they are coated in wheat flour) and fried in a shared fryer before being dunked in the same glaze as the regular donuts. Sugar Shack is amazing for non-GF people and fad-dieters but no one with an allergy should eat here. Staff is knowledgeable and will inform you of that.
